Enemy drones attacked Volgograd region

Enemy drones attacked the Volgograd region overnight, the Russian Ministry of Defense reported this morning. The exact number of drones destroyed over the region is unknown.
According to the ministry, a total of 391 UAVs were shot down over Russian regions.
«During the night from 20:00 on July 19 to 8:00 on July 20, air defense systems on duty intercepted and destroyed 381 Ukrainian fixed-wing unmanned aerial vehicles over the territories of Belgorod, Bryansk, Volgograd, Voronezh, Kaluga, Kursk, Lipetsk, Oryol, Rostov, Ryazan, Smolensk, Tambov, Tula oblasts, the Moscow region, Krasnodar Krai, the Republic of Crimea, and over the waters of the Sea of Azov and the Black Sea,» the ministry clarified.
Recall that on the night of July 20, a drone threat alert was declared in the Volgograd region. Residents received SMS notifications from the Russian Emergency Situations Ministry (RSChS) asking them to stay indoors and take shelter in a windowless room. Volgograd Airport operated normally. The all-clear was given on the morning of July 20.
